June 11, 2019—KB4503269 (Security-only update)

Improvements and fixes

This security update includes quality improvements. Key changes include:

  • Security updates to Windows App Platform and Frameworks, Microsoft Graphics Component, Windows Input and Composition, Windows Shell, Windows Server, Windows Authentication, Windows Datacenter Networking, Windows Storage and Filesystems, Windows Virtualization, Internet Information Services, and the Microsoft JET Database Engine.
    For more information about the resolved security vulnerabilities, please refer to the Security Update Guide.

Known issues in this update

Symptom Workaround
When trying to expand, view, or create Custom Viewsin Event Viewer, you may receive the error, “MMC has detected an error in a snap-in and will unload it.” and the app may stop responding or close. You may also receive the same error when using Filter Current Login the Actionmenu with built-in views or logs. Built-in views and other features of Event Viewer should work as expected. This issue is resolved in KB4508772.
Devices that start up using Preboot Execution Environment (PXE) images from Windows Deployment Services (WDS) or System Center Configuration Manager (SCCM) may fail to start with the error “Status: 0xc0000001, Info: A required device isn’t connected or can’t be accessed” after installing this update on a WDS server. For mitigation instructions, see KB4512816.We are working on a resolution and will provide an update in an upcoming release.

How to get this update

Before installing this updateMicrosoft strongly recommends you install the latest servicing stack update (SSU) for your operating system before installing the latest Rollup. SSUs improve the reliability of the update process to mitigate potential issues while installing the Rollup and applying Microsoft security fixes. If you are using Windows Update, the latest SSU (KB4490628) will be offered to you automatically. To get the standalone package for the latest SSU, search for it in the Microsoft Update Catalog.Install this updateThis update is now available for installation through WSUS. To get the standalone package for this update, go to the Microsoft Update Catalog website.File informationFor a list of the files that are provided in this update, download the file information for update 4503269.
